Understanding the GPU Landscape

Graphics processing units (GPUs) are essential for the AI boom, powering large language models (LLMs) used in various applications. As demand for AI technology rises, businesses face the challenge of managing fluctuating GPU costs. Industries like finance and pharmaceuticals, which traditionally do not deal with variable costs, must adapt quickly to this new reality. Nvidia leads the GPU market, and its products are in high demand, driving up valuations and creating supply challenges.

Key Insights on GPU Cost Management

  • The GPU market could grow to over $400 billion in five years due to AI advancements.
  • Supply issues stem from manufacturing limits and geopolitical risks, especially concerning Taiwan.
  • Companies may consider managing their own GPU servers to control costs better and ensure availability.
  • Geographic location plays a crucial role in cost management, with regions like Norway offering cheaper electricity.
  • Accurate demand forecasting is challenging due to rapid advancements in AI and emerging applications.
